Tuesday ended with US stocks plummeting to a low with inflation numbers coming out slightly higher than the previous month. Hopes for the rate cut by the Federal Reserve have dashed. Meanwhile, the cryptocurrencies have demonstrated market defying movements on the price chart.

US Stocks on Tuesday-End

US stocks and multiple indexes fell as Tuesday concluded. Dow and S&P 500 plunged by 08% and 0.2%, respectively. Nasdaq also fell by 0.1%. What added concern to this decline was a fall in the share values of Visa and Mastercard by 4.5% and 3.8%, applicable in the same order.

A report by Reuters quoted JPMorgan CEO Jamie Dimon saying that Trump’s recent proposal to cap credit card rates could hurt financial companies more. US President Donald Trump recently proposed capping credit card rates at 10%, down from 20-30%, in a bid to make borrowing more affordable.

Notably, shares of JPMorgan also declined by 4.2% on the sidelines. The financial sector, overall, fell by 1.8%.

US Inflation Data

Data for US inflation in December 2025 is finally out. It shows a slightly higher rate of 2.71% as of December 31, 2025. This is up from 2.68% as of November 30, 2025. Chances for no rate cut were last seen to be around 94.5%. Experts now say that any hope whatsoever of a rate cut has been dashed with the recent inflation data.

November 2025 was the first time since April 2025 that inflation dropped. It has been rising constantly since then, except for October 2025, when data was not rolled out because of the Government shutdown. Nevertheless, December’s inflation reportedly remains lower than the long-term average of 3.27%.

What Happens to the Crypto Market?

Lowering lending rates by slashing them essentially strengthens investors’ capacity to borrow. Thereby, boosting liquidity in volatile sectors like crypto. However, the market is defying the trend as of now.

Two top tokens, BTC and ETH, have surged by 3.29% and 6.40% over the last 24 hours, respectively. They are now trading at $94,757.63 and $3,323.80, applicable in the same order. The global market cap has soared by 4.61% to $3.25 trillion, with the FGI rating shifting to 52 points when the article is being written.

XRP, BNB, and SOL are a few more gainers with an upswing of 4.04%, 3.33%, and 3.01% during the same time frame, respectively.

China’s central bank, led by Deputy Governor Lu Lei, initiated a trial of a unified cross-border QR code payment gateway with Alipay and Ant International as participants. This pilot addresses cross-border fund risks, aiming to enhance financial security amid rising money laundering through digital channels, despite muted crypto market reactions. China’s Cross-Border Payment Gateway Trial with Alipay The trial operation of a unified cross-border QR code payment gateway marks a milestone in China’s financial landscape. Prominent entities such as Alipay and Ant International are at the forefront, participating as the initial institutions in this venture. Lu Lei, Deputy Governor of the People’s Bank of China, highlighted the systemic risks posed by increased cross-border fund flows. Changes are expected in the dynamics of digital transactions, potentially enhancing transaction efficiency while tightening regulations around illicit finance. The initiative underscores China’s commitment to bolstering financial security amidst growing global fund movements. “The scale of cross-border fund flows is expanding, and the frequency is accelerating, providing opportunities for risks such as cross-border money laundering and terrorist financing. Some overseas illegal platforms transfer funds through channels such as virtual currencies and underground banks, creating a ‘resonance’ of risks at home and abroad, posing a challenge to China’s foreign exchange management and financial security.” — Lu Lei, Deputy Governor, People’s Bank of China Bitcoin and Impact of China’s Financial Initiatives Did you know? China’s latest initiative echoes the Payment Connect project of June 2025, furthering real-time cross-boundary remittances and expanding its influence on global financial systems.
